Image Credit: Getty Images Jeff Bezos‘s ex-wife, Mackenzie Scott, has become a prominent philanthropist since divorcing the Amazon founder and becoming one of the richest women in the world. As part of the divorce settlement, she received 25% of their shared Amazon stock, which represented a 4% stake in the company, valued at around $35.6 billion at the time. Since then, she has donated over $19 billion to charity. Here’s a closer look at Bezos’s personal life, his net worth, and more below. Is Jeff Bezos Married? Launched in 2015, “Made in China 2025” (MIC 2025) is a strategic blueprint by the Chinese government aimed at transforming the nation from a low-cost manufacturing hub into a global leader in high-tech industries. Inspired by Germany’s “Industry 4.0” strategy, MIC 2025 focuses on upgrading China’s industrial capabilities, reducing reliance on foreign technology and fostering innovation to move up the global value chain. Objectives and Key Sectors The initiative targets ten key sectors deemed critical for future economic growth and national security. The long-term impact of lockdown on wedding trends included more outdoor ceremonies and shorter timescales for planning, the inquiry heard. The Scottish Covid-19 Inquiry’s worship and life events impact hearings began on Tuesday, with evidence from faith leaders from different denominations including the Catholic Church, Free Church of Scotland, as well as from the Humanist Society Scotland and the Jewish Council of Scotland. Fraser Sutherland, of the Humanist Society Scotland, said as recently as 2024, weddings were going ahead which had been postponed during the pandemic, and branded some restrictions “bizarre”.
